JPMorgan Chase Revenue 1986-2025 | JPM

JPMorgan Chase annual/quarterly revenue history and growth rate from 1986 to 2025. Revenue can be defined as the amount of money a company receives from its customers in exchange for the sales of goods or services. Revenue is the top line item on an income statement from which all costs and expenses are subtracted to arrive at net income.
  • JPMorgan Chase revenue for the quarter ending September 30, 2025 was $71.900B, a 3.21% increase year-over-year.
  • JPMorgan Chase revenue for the twelve months ending September 30, 2025 was $277.718B, a 1.42% increase year-over-year.
  • JPMorgan Chase annual revenue for 2024 was $278.906B, a 16.49% increase from 2023.
  • JPMorgan Chase annual revenue for 2023 was $239.425B, a 54.68% increase from 2022.
  • JPMorgan Chase annual revenue for 2022 was $154.792B, a 21.69% increase from 2021.
JPMorgan Chase Annual Revenue
(Millions of US $)
2024 $278,906
2023 $239,425
2022 $154,792
2021 $127,202
2020 $129,911
2019 $142,515
2018 $129,824
2017 $114,579
2016 $106,387
2015 $101,006
2014 $103,009
2013 $106,717
2012 $108,074
2011 $110,838
2010 $115,475
2009 $115,632
2008 $101,491
2007 $116,353
2006 $99,864
2005 $79,768
2004 $56,305
2003 $44,463
2002 $43,372
2001 $50,723
2000 $60,317
1999 $51,852
1998 $32,379
1997 $30,381
1996 $27,421
1995 $26,368
1994 $12,377
1993 $12,427
1992 $12,174
1991 $14,111
1990 $15,783
1989 $8,227
1988 $7,644
1987 $6,755
1986 $5,488
1985 $5,651

Fatal error: Uncaught TypeError: number_format(): Argument #1 ($num) must be of type float, string given in /var/www/html/macrotrends/public_html/assets/php/new_chart_page_NEW.php:2820 Stack trace: #0 /var/www/html/macrotrends/public_html/assets/php/new_chart_page_NEW.php(2820): number_format() #1 /var/www/html/macrotrends/public_html/assets/php/url_router.php(168): include('...') #2 {main} thrown in /var/www/html/macrotrends/public_html/assets/php/new_chart_page_NEW.php on line 2820
JPMorgan Chase Quarterly Revenue
(Millions of US $)
2025-09-30 $71,900
2025-06-30 $69,944
2025-03-31 $68,890
2024-12-31 $66,984
2024-09-30 $69,665
2024-06-30 $75,967
2024-03-31 $66,290
2023-12-31 $61,907
2023-09-30 $61,704
2023-06-30 $61,172
2023-03-31 $54,642
2022-12-31 $47,409
2022-09-30 $40,809
2022-06-30 $34,233
2022-03-31 $32,341
2021-12-31 $30,675
2021-09-30 $31,047
2021-06-30 $31,832
2021-03-31 $33,648
2020-12-31 $30,627
2020-09-30 $30,942
2020-06-30 $35,334
2020-03-31 $33,008
2019-12-31 $34,320
2019-09-30 $36,184
2019-06-30 $35,952
2019-03-31 $36,059
2018-12-31 $31,909
2018-09-30 $32,791
2018-06-30 $32,834
2018-03-31 $32,290
2017-12-31 $28,022
2017-09-30 $29,467
2017-06-30 $29,173
2017-03-31 $27,917
2016-12-31 $26,990
2016-09-30 $27,140
2016-06-30 $26,846
2016-03-31 $25,411
2015-12-31 $24,815
2015-09-30 $24,595
2015-06-30 $25,642
2015-03-31 $25,954
2014-12-31 $24,639
2014-09-30 $26,288
2014-06-30 $26,741
2014-03-31 $25,341
2013-12-31 $26,176
2013-09-30 $25,408
2013-06-30 $27,579
2013-03-31 $27,554
2012-12-31 $26,055
2012-09-30 $27,799
2012-06-30 $25,133
2012-03-31 $29,087
2011-12-31 $24,394
2011-09-30 $27,106
2011-06-30 $30,575
2011-03-31 $28,763
2010-12-31 $29,608
2010-09-30 $26,928
2010-06-30 $28,133
2010-03-31 $30,806
2009-12-31 $26,401
2009-09-30 $30,145
2009-06-30 $29,502
2009-03-31 $29,584
2008-12-31 $25,025
2008-09-30 $23,069
2008-06-30 $26,634
2008-03-31 $26,763
2007-12-31 $28,780
2007-09-30 $28,005
2007-06-30 $30,082
2007-03-31 $29,486
2006-12-31 $26,598
2006-09-30 $25,323
2006-06-30 $24,525
2006-03-31 $23,418
2005-12-31 $21,510
2005-09-30 $20,772
2005-06-30 $18,432
2005-03-31 $19,054
2004-12-31 $16,857
2004-09-30 $16,546
2004-06-30 $11,251
2004-03-31 $11,651
2003-12-31 $10,746
2003-09-30 $10,421
2003-06-30 $11,842
2003-03-31 $11,454
2002-12-31 $10,698
2002-09-30 $10,527
2002-06-30 $11,190
2002-03-31 $10,957
2001-12-31 $10,528
2001-09-30 $12,471
2001-06-30 $12,637
2001-03-31 $15,087
2000-12-31 $16,004
2000-09-30 $14,803
2000-06-30 $14,463
2000-03-31 $14,795
1999-12-31 $9,334
1999-09-30 $8,017
1999-06-30 $8,344
1999-03-31 $7,967
1998-12-31 $8,136
1998-09-30 $7,627
1998-06-30 $8,352
1998-03-31 $8,258
1997-12-31 $7,808
1997-09-30 $6,631
1997-06-30 $7,491
1997-03-31 $7,224
1996-12-31 $8,673
1996-09-30 $6,774
1996-06-30 $6,698
1996-03-31 $5,276
1995-12-31 $3,810
1995-09-30 $3,810
1995-06-30 $6,626
1995-03-31 $3,536
1994-12-31 $3,021
1994-09-30 $3,297
1994-06-30 $3,086
1994-03-31 $2,973
1993-12-31 $3,170
1993-09-30 $3,077
1993-06-30 $3,174
1993-03-31 $3,006
1992-12-31 $2,876
1992-09-30 $3,031
1992-06-30 $3,036
1992-03-31 $3,231
1991-12-31 $3,494
1991-09-30 $3,483
1991-06-30 $3,462
1991-03-31 $3,672
1990-12-31 $9,771
1990-09-30 $1,984
1990-06-30 $1,946
1990-03-31 $2,082
1989-12-31 $2,086
1989-09-30 $2,076
1989-06-30 $2,131
1989-03-31 $1,935
1988-12-31 $1,992
1988-09-30 $1,946
1988-06-30 $1,855
1988-03-31 $1,851
1987-12-31 $2,020
1987-09-30 $1,747
1987-06-30 $1,638
1987-03-31 $1,350
1986-12-31